Background
Morris, Daniel Kearns was born on January 14, 1954 in Youngstown, Ohio, United States. Son of John Mackey and Nancy Todd (Kearns) Morris.

Student, Boston University, 1972-1973; AB, University of Michigan, 1978.
Volunteers in Service to America volunteer, Winnebago (Nebraska) Indian Reservation, 1977-1978; editor, Pierian Press, Ann Arbor, Michigan, 1979-1981; public, editor, Alternative Review of Literature and Politics magazine, Ann Arbor, 1981-1982; press secretary, Richard Fellman for United States Congress campaign, Omaha, 1982; producer, editor, National Public Radio, Washington, 1983-1988; producer, Columbia Broadcasting System News, Washington, 1988-1991; producer, ABC News Nightline, Washington, since 1991.
Field organizer McGovern for President, Washington, 1972.
Married Lisa Rachel Herrick, August 25, 1984. Children: Sarah Herrick, Nicholas Herrick.
